ENGINE OIL RECOMMENDATION
Use MotorcraftSAE 5W-50 full synthetic or an equivalent SAE 5W-50
full synthetic oil meeting Ford specification WSS-M2C931-B.
Do not use supplemental engine oil additives, cleaners or other engine
treatments. They are unnecessary and could lead to engine damage that
is not covered by Ford warranty.
Change your engine oil and filter according to the appropriate schedule
listed in thescheduled maintenance information.

1Add the coolant type originally equipped in your vehicle.2Rear axle lubricants do not need to be checked or changed unless a leak is suspected, service is
required, the axle assembly has been submerged in water, or when subjecting your car to
high-speed and/or competition use. The axle lubricant and friction modifier should be changed any
time the rear axle has been submerged in water. The axle lubricant and friction modifier should
also be changed after the initial (first) hour of high-speed operation or if the vehicle is subjected to
track or competition conditions; thereafter changing the axle lubricant and friction modifier every
12 hours (under these conditions).

DRIVETRAIN
Item Description
Rear axle8.8 in. solid rear axle with limited-slip
differential 3.73:1 ratio
Driveshaft2-piece steel
TransmissionMT82 6-speed manual with integral clutch
housing
Gear ratiosGear Ratio
1st 3.66
2nd 2.43
3rd 1.69
4th 1.31
5th 1.00
6th 0.65
Reverse 3.32
ENGINE INFORMATION
Item Description
Configuration90-degree V8
Aluminum block
Aluminum high flow cylinder
heads
Engine weight - 444 lb. (201 kg)
Bore x stroke92.2 x 92.7 mm
(3.63 x 3.65 inches)
Displacement302 cubic inches (5.0L)
Compression ratio11.0:1

Item Description
Valve trainCompact RFF (roller finger
followers)
Four valves per cylinder
Cam timingTwin independent variable
Fuel systemSequential mechanical returnless
fuel injection
Ignition systemCoil on plug, two knock sensors
Firing order1–5–4–8–6–3–7–2
Throttle bodySingle bore 80 mm
PistonsForged aluminum
CrankshaftFully counterweighted forged steel
Connecting rodsHigh strength forged powder
metal/floating pin
Intake manifoldRunners in a box composite
Exhaust manifoldsPulse separated stainless steel
tubular headers

REAR SEAT DELETE PANELS (IF EQUIPPED)
In the event of battery failure, you can access the trunk area by doing
the following:
1. Remove the two top fasteners by
turning them counterclockwise.
2. Remove the trunk access panel
(located behind the cross brace) by
pulling it slightly down while
pushing it rearward (toward the
trunk).
To remove the rear floor panel, do the following:
1. Remove the two top fasteners by
turning them counterclockwise.
2. Lift the top of the two bottom
fasteners with a flat-end
screwdriver, then remove them.
3. Remove the rear floor panel.
4. Remove the trunk access panel
(located behind the cross brace) by
pulling it slightly down while
pushing it rearward (toward the
trunk).
